The importance of choosing the right healthcare provider

When it comes to your health, choosing the right healthcare provider is crucial. Whether you’re looking for a primary care doctor or a specialist, finding someone who can meet your specific needs is essential for your overall well-being. The right healthcare provider will not only provide you with the necessary medical treatment but also offer support, guidance, and a sense of trust.

With so many options available, it can be overwhelming to make this decision. However, by considering a few key factors, you can ensure that you choose the right healthcare provider for your needs.

Factors to consider when choosing a primary care doctor

Experience and Credentials: One of the first factors to consider when choosing a healthcare provider is their experience and credentials. Look for providers who have a solid educational background, relevant certifications, and years of experience in their field. This will give you confidence in their ability to provide high-quality care.

Specialization: Depending on your specific healthcare needs, it’s important to find a provider who specializes in the area of medicine that is relevant to you. Whether you’re seeking a primary care doctor, a dermatologist, or an orthopedic surgeon, finding a provider who has expertise in treating your particular condition or concern is essential.

Reputation and Reviews: Researching the reputation and reviews of healthcare providers can give you valuable insights into their quality of care. Look for online reviews, testimonials, and ratings from previous patients. Additionally, ask for recommendations from friends, family, or other healthcare professionals who may have had experience with the provider you are considering.

How to find a doctor for you

Finding a primary care doctor is an important step in managing your overall health. A primary care doctor serves as your first point of contact for any non-emergency medical concerns and coordinates your healthcare needs.

First, consider asking friends, family, or other healthcare professionals for referrals as they may have had positive experiences with certain doctors. Additionally, it’s important to check if the primary care doctor you’re interested in accepts your health insurance to avoid unexpected costs and ensure coverage for your visits. You can also make use of online directories provided by your insurance company or reputable healthcare organizations, which offer valuable details like the doctor’s specialty, education, and contact information, making it easier to find a suitable primary care doctor in your area.

Questions to ask during your search

During your search for a primary care doctor, it’s essential to ask relevant questions to ensure that they meet your specific needs. Here are some important questions to consider:

What is their approach to preventive care? A primary care doctor’s focus on preventive care can greatly impact your long-term health. Inquire about their philosophy on preventive screenings, vaccinations, and lifestyle modifications to promote wellness.

How do they handle emergencies or after-hours care? It’s important to understand how your primary care doctor handles emergencies or after-hours care. Do they have a protocol for urgent situations, and will they be available when you need them the most?

Are they open to communication and collaboration? Building a strong relationship with your primary care doctor requires open communication and collaboration. Ask about their availability for appointments, their preferred communication methods, and their willingness to work with other specialists if needed.

Tips for getting a primary care doctor

When selecting a primary care doctor, it’s important to consider more than just finding the right provider. To ensure a smooth transition and establish a successful doctor-patient relationship, there are additional tips to keep in mind.

First, prepare for your first visit by gathering any relevant medical records, test results, or a list of medications you are currently taking. This will help your primary care doctor obtain a comprehensive understanding of your medical history and provide appropriate care. It is also very important to ensure the practice you’re looking into accepts your health care insurance plan. This will help you avoid unexpected expenses and ensure that your visits are covered.

Additionally, prioritize open and honest communication to establish trust with your doctor. Share your symptoms, concerns, and lifestyle choices to enable accurate diagnosis and personalized treatment plans.

Lastly, be sure to follow your primary care doctor’s recommendations, which may include lifestyle modifications, screenings, or vaccinations aimed at improving your overall health. Actively participating in your own healthcare will contribute to better outcomes and a stronger partnership with your primary care provider.

How to build a relationship with your physician

Building a strong relationship with your primary care doctor is essential for effective healthcare. Here are some tips to foster a positive doctor-patient relationship:

Communication: Establish open and honest communication with your primary care doctor. Share your concerns, symptoms, and goals, and ask questions to ensure that you have a clear understanding of your healthcare.

Active Participation: Take an active role in your healthcare by following your primary care doctor’s recommendations, attending regular check-ups, and adhering to prescribed treatments. Actively participating in your own healthcare can lead to better outcomes.

Trust and Collaboration: Trust is the foundation of any successful doctor-patient relationship. Trust your primary care doctor’s expertise and judgment, and collaborate with them in decision-making regarding your healthcare.

The role of a primary care physician in preventive care

Preventive care is essential for maintaining good health and avoiding future health problems, and your primary care physician plays a critical role in delivering it. Here’s how your primary care physician contributes to preventive care:

One of the key ways your primary care physician promotes preventive care is through regular check-ups. These appointments enable your doctor to assess your overall health, monitor existing conditions, and identify potential risks early on. By detecting health issues at an early stage, interventions can be implemented to reduce the likelihood of complications down the line.

In addition, primary care physicians ensure that you receive the necessary vaccinations based on factors such as your age, medical history, and lifestyle. By keeping you up to date on recommended vaccinations, they protect you from infectious diseases and contribute to the prevention of community-wide outbreaks.

Furthermore, primary care physicians conduct various health screenings to proactively identify potential health problems. These screenings encompass essential checks such as blood pressure measurements, cholesterol screenings, and cancer screenings. By catching these issues before they escalate, your doctor can intervene promptly and help you take preventive measures.

By providing regular check-ups, administering vaccinations, and conducting health screenings, your primary care physician plays a crucial role in keeping you healthy and preventing future health complications. Establishing a strong partnership with your primary care provider will empower you to prioritize preventive care and maintain your well-being.
